扇區 磁軌 柱面和簇的介紹

2021-09-01 16:21:47 字數 738 閱讀 4239

一直以來對這幾個概念非常模糊,最近看ramdisk(感覺wdf和wdm差距好大啊),就認真的看了下概念,嘿嘿。首先可以想象成一跟由很多圓形碟片組成的圓柱體。

磁軌:track,可以理解為乙個圓形碟片由許許多多的同心圓組成,每乙個同心圓可以認為是乙個磁軌。(硬碟是乙個高速旋轉的東西,當磁碟旋轉時,磁頭若保持在乙個位置上不動,則磁頭會在磁碟表面劃出乙個圓形軌跡,這些圓形軌跡就叫做磁軌)

扇區:sector,可以聯想到「扇形區域」,磁碟上的每個磁軌被等分為若干個弧段,這些弧段便是磁碟的扇區,每個扇區的大小為512個位元組,磁碟驅動器在向磁碟讀取和寫入資料時應該以扇區為單位。

柱面:cylinder,硬碟通常由重疊的一組碟片構成,每個盤面都被劃分為數目相等的磁軌,並從外緣的0開始編號,具有相同編號的磁軌形成乙個圓柱,稱之為磁碟的柱面。顯然,磁碟的柱面數與乙個盤面上的磁軌數是相等的。

磁頭:head,當然是讀取資訊用的了。每個盤面都有自己的磁頭,如果盤面的雙面都記錄資訊,那麼雙面都應該有磁頭。所以,硬碟的容量計算公式如下:硬碟的容量=柱面數×磁頭數×扇區數×512(位元組數)

sdk中定義了乙個叫做disk_geometry的結構體:

typedef

struct _disk_geometry

disk_geometry;

其他資訊以後補全:mbr、dbr等

盤面,磁軌,柱面,扇區

磁碟結構及讀寫特性 另一篇 1.盤面 乙個碟片都有兩個盤面 side 即上 下盤面,一般每個盤面都會利 用,都可以儲存資料,成為 有效碟片,也有極個別的硬碟盤面數為單數。每乙個這樣的有效盤面都有乙個盤面號,按順序從上至下從 0 開始依次編號。在硬碟系 統中,盤面號又叫磁頭號,因為每乙個有效盤面都有乙...

磁軌,扇區,柱面簡介

當磁碟旋轉時,磁頭若保持在乙個位置上,則每個磁頭都會在磁碟表面劃出乙個圓形軌跡,這些圓形軌跡叫做磁軌。磁軌用肉眼看不見,以特殊方式磁化了一些磁化區,磁碟上的資訊便是沿著這樣的軌道存在的。相鄰的磁軌並不緊挨著,因為磁化單元相鄰太近時磁性會產生影響,同時為磁頭讀寫帶來困難。磁碟上的每個磁軌被分為若干個弧...

盤面,磁軌,柱面,扇區

來自 1.盤面 乙個碟片都有兩個盤面 side 即上 下盤面,一般每個盤面都會利 用,都可以儲存資料,成為有效碟片,也有極個別的硬碟盤面數為單數。每乙個這樣的有效盤面都有乙個盤面號,按順序從上至下從 0 開始依次編號。在硬碟系 統中,盤面號又叫磁頭號,因為每乙個有效盤面都有乙個對應的讀寫磁頭。硬碟的...